Major Los Angeles County, California Real Estate Markets

The county's real estate landscape divides into distinct market ecosystems, each with unique characteristics and price dynamics. The Westside commands premium valuations with cities like Santa Monica, Venice, and Culver City leading luxury and tech-driven demand, while the San Fernando Valley offers more accessible entry points in communities such as Burbank, Glendale, and Woodland Hills. Meanwhile, the South Bay markets of Torrance, Redondo Beach, and Palos Verdes attract families seeking coastal proximity with suburban amenities.

Emerging markets in previously overlooked areas continue reshaping the county's real estate narrative, with neighborhoods like Silver Lake, Highland Park, and parts of South Los Angeles experiencing significant appreciation driven by demographic shifts and infrastructure improvements. The San Gabriel Valley, including cities like Pasadena, Arcadia, and Alhambra, has become increasingly attractive to international buyers, particularly from Asia, creating distinct market dynamics that require specialized expertise and cultural understanding.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Los Angeles County's real estate market operates more like a collection of interconnected submarkets than a single unified system, with micro-neighborhoods often showing dramatically different trends within the same ZIP code. Factors such as school district boundaries, proximity to major employers like entertainment studios or tech companies, and transportation access via Metro lines create complex valuation patterns that challenge even experienced agents to master comprehensively.

The market's complexity extends beyond geography to include diverse housing stock ranging from historic Craftsman homes in South Pasadena to ultra-modern condominiums in West Hollywood, each requiring specialized knowledge about maintenance, regulations, and buyer expectations. Seasonal patterns vary significantly across different price segments, with luxury markets showing distinct cycles compared to starter home segments, while rental markets in areas near major universities and employment centers maintain their own rhythms independent of sales activity.
